PEDR 7222 - Pediatric Medicine Rotation (3 Credit Hours)
First year pediatric dentistry residents participate in a two-week rotation in pediatric medicine at the AU Children’s Hospital of Georgia. Residents learn the skills necessary to obtain and evaluate a systems based complete physical examination of infants, children and adolescents, and are introduced to ancillary tests and diagnostic records necessary to discriminate and assess the degree of wellness for children with a wide variety of health problems. Residents are provided training in hospital admission, writing orders, writing notes in the medical record, daily management of hospitalized or ambulatory ill children and dictating discharge summaries. Residents participate in the seminars, lectures and conferences conducted by this service.
